House Leveling in Cohasset, MA
House leveling services involve adjusting the foundation of a home to correct uneven or sagging floors, cracks, and structural issues caused by shifting soil, moisture changes, or poor construction. These projects typically include lifting and stabilizing the foundation to restore proper alignment, ensuring the home’s stability and safety. Property owners often seek house leveling when noticing signs of foundation settlement, such as cracked walls, sticking doors, or uneven flooring, and want to understand the scope of work, potential costs, and how the process may impact their property.
Before requesting house leveling services, homeowners should assess the extent of foundation movement and identify specific problem areas. Understanding the types of foundation issues present, the methods used for stabilization, and any necessary repairs to interior or exterior elements can help in planning the project. Clear communication about the current condition of the property and desired outcomes is essential for ensuring the work addresses the underlying issues effectively.

Common House Leveling Jobs
Foundation leveling - stabilizes and corrects uneven or sinking foundations for safety and structural integrity.
Slab jacking - raises and supports sunken concrete slabs in driveways, patios, and walkways.
Pier and beam leveling - restores proper alignment of homes built on pier and beam foundations.
Soil stabilization - improves soil conditions to prevent future settlement and shifting.
Crack repair and reinforcement - addresses foundation cracks to reinforce stability and prevent further damage.
Structural assessment and correction - evaluates foundation issues and implements necessary leveling solutions.
House Leveling Questions
What is house leveling? House leveling involves adjusting the foundation to correct uneven settling, ensuring the structure is stable and level.
When is house leveling needed? House leveling may be necessary if there are noticeable cracks, uneven floors, or doors and windows that don’t close properly.
What methods are used for house leveling? Common methods include pier and beam adjustments, mudjacking, or underpinning, depending on the foundation type and condition.
How can property owners tell if their house needs leveling? Signs include cracked walls, sloping floors, or gaps around doors and windows that no longer close properly.
